首页
登录
从业资格
下类图中,类Class1和Class2之间是( )关系。 A.关联 B.聚
下类图中,类Class1和Class2之间是( )关系。 A.关联 B.聚
考试题库
2022-08-02
17
问题
下类图中,类Class1和Class2之间是( )关系。
A.关联B.聚合C.组合D.继承
选项
A.关联
B.聚合
C.组合
D.继承
答案
C
解析
在面向对象技术中,类之间的关系从宏观上可以分为关联、依赖、继承,而其中关 联又有两种特例:聚合和组合。
关联表示类之间的“持久”关系,这种关系一般表示一种重要的业务之间的关系, 需要保存的,或者说需要“持久化”的,或者说需要保存到数据库中的。依赖表示类之 间的是一种“临时、短暂”关系,这种关系是不需要保存的。关联表示类之间的很强的 关系,依赖表示类之间的较弱的关系。关联是一种结构关系,说明一个事物的对象与另 一个事物的对象相联系。给定一个连接两个类的关联,可以从一个类的对象导航到另一个类的对象。
聚合关系(Aggregation)是关联关系的一种,代表两个类之间的整体/局部关系。聚合 暗示着整体在概念上处于比局部更高的一个级别,而关联暗示两个类在概念上位于相同 的级别。如汽车类与引擎类、轮胎类之间的关系就是整体与个体的关系。
组成关系(Composition)是聚合的一种特殊形式,它要求普通的聚合关系中代表的对象负责代表部分的对象的生命周期,组成关系是不能共享的。
转载请注明原文地址:https://www.tihaiku.com/congyezige/2418023.html
本试题收录于:
中级 软件评测师题库软件水平考试初中高级分类
中级 软件评测师
软件水平考试初中高级
相关试题推荐
零件关系P(零件名,条形码,供应商,产地,价格)中的()属性可以作为该关系的
零件关系P(零件名,条形码,供应商,产地,价格)中的()属性可以作为该关系的
假设系统中进程的三态模型如下图所示,图中的a和b处应分别填写(),图中的c和
假设系统中进程的三态模型如下图所示,图中的a和b处应分别填写(),图中的c和
阅读以下说明和流程图,填补流程图中的空缺(1)~(5),将解答填入答题纸的对应栏
设有员工关系Emp(员工号,姓名,性别,部门,家庭住址),其中,属性“性别”的取
UML图中既包含展示系统动态特性的动态视图,又包括展示系统静态特性的静态视图,
设学生关系Students(Sno,Sname,Sex,Sdept,Sage,S
设学生关系Students(Sno,Sname,Sex,Sdept,Sage,S
某公司数据库的两个关系:部门(部门号,部门名,负责人,电话)和员工(员工号,姓
随机试题
______pollutioncontrolmeasuresareexpensive,manylocalgovernmentshesitate
Nosooner______(我刚点着蜡烛)thanitwasputout.hadIlitthecandle由给出的中英文可知,句子中
[originaltext]Ken:Hello,Rob.Rob:Hello,Ken...HelloBarbara.Comei
【教案】 TeachingAims Knowledgeaim: Studentscanunderstandthisshortpassage
下面是某老师布置的一道习题和某同学的解答过程。 问题: (1)指出这道作
倪老师在园长以及全员老师的帮助下获得了市一等奖教师,倪老师觉得这是她一个人的功劳
下列英文缩写错误的是A.肾素-血管紧张素系统(RAS)B.血管紧张素转化酶抑制药
从所给的四个选项中,选择最合适的一个填入问号处,使之呈现一定的规律性: A.如
下列各物质的化学键中,只存在σ键的是: A.PH3B.H2C=CH2C
女性,35岁,反复患风湿病已15年,并继发风湿性心瓣膜病。主要表现为二尖瓣狭窄,
最新回复
(
0
)